[0024] The learner agent of reinforcement learning, which is the wireless sensor node in this invention, how to take a series of actions in the environment, so as to obtain the maximum cumulative reward. Keep trying and delaying rewards are two very distinctive characteristics of reinforcement learning. Through continuous interaction with the environment, the feedback data enables the agent to continuously learn and choose actions that maximize benefits.
